Admission Requirements
Academic Requirements
Candidates must satisfy the general requirements for admission to the Faculty of Graduate Studies. To be admitted to the MCSc or MACSc all students must have completed an undergraduate program in Computer Science with high standing. Students with high standing in a non-computer science undergraduate program may be admitted to the MACSc program with an additional requirement of core undergraduate Computer Science courses in addition to the graduate Computer Science courses. To be admitted to the PhD program all students must have completed a thesis-based Master\'s degree in Computer Science.
For application you need to have:
- Four-year Bachelors degree
- Minimum grade point average (GPA) of 3.0 (B average) in the last 60 credit hours of study
- Degree granted by university of recognized standing
English language proficiency
Students for whom English is not their first language and who did not complete their previous degree at an English-speaking university will need to submit proof of English language proficiency.
Dalhousie accepts a number of different English proficiency test scores:
- Internet-based TOEFL: 92
- Written TOEFL: 580
- MELAB: 85
- IELTS: 7
- CanTest: 4.5 (with no band score lower than 4.0)
- CAEL: 70 with no band score lower than 60
- Dalhousie College of Continuing Education (CCE):A-
